Lastly, today is the 5th of November. The fireworks are crazy tonight, maybe even more than the 4th of July. Why? The 5th of November is the day that Guy Fawkes and members of the Catholic church were caught and prevented from carrying out their plot of blowing up the British Parliament and King in 1605.

So during the wait for the bus I got on my laptop and tried to figure out how to get my nook books onto a kindle. It’s legally impossible because, all of the companies employ DRM or digital rights management. This is basically a way of making sure you can’t use any other reader than the one they provide. Which also means even of you purchased an eBook; you don’t own it. I finally caught the bus home and watched some Netflix before bed.
